Apply: DRC Area Programme Manager

Deadline: 23 December, 2020

Location: Maiduguri, Nigeria

Danish Refugee Council (DRC) is seeking applications from eligible applicants for the post of Area Programme Manager.

DRC provides direct assistance to conflict-affected populations – refugees, and internally displaced people (IDPs).

Responsibilities

  • Ensure effective community engagement and safety analysis for responses according to needs identified in protection, food security, WASH/shelter, protection and monitoring and evaluation, while linking with other sectors within DRC (AVR/MRE and NTS)
  • Ensure appropriate selection of beneficiaries or areas to be targeted following technical methodologies defined by relevant coordinators and with the agreement/support of local communities
  • Ensure appropriate monitoring and evaluation support is provided to the programme
  • Work closely with all the support teams in Maiduguri and Yobe to ensure the required means are available on time to implement activities following established workplan
  • Be the focal point for interacting with other programmes/activities implemented in Borno and Yobe
  • Liaise with the protection coordinator, WASH/shelter coordinator, livelihoods coordinator, food security coordinator and monitoring and evaluation coordinator to get required technical inputs to match good quality standards for the respective activities
  • Line manage national staff by conducting performance reviews, setting objectives and ensuring expected performance criteria are met
  • Adapt the team structure according to needs, resources and capacities, if required, with technical coordinator support
  • Develop job descriptions and recruit qualified staff (national) for the relevant position under programme sector
  • Ensure high quality project implementation in accordance with donor and DRC regulations as well as in line with agreed log frames/indicators, budgets, procurement plans, and workplans
  • Review BFUs regarding activities/projects and check the good budget allocation of the related costs

Requirements

  • Master’s degree in Social Sciences or any of the technical sectors
  • Five years, minimum, of work experience in managing programme in humanitarian context and experience in complex emergencies and high-security environments
  • Knowledge of access management in a high-security context, and demonstrated ability to liaise with a variety of stakeholders in a professional and adaptive manner, including security actors and local authorities
  • Work experiences with at least three of the four sectors to be covered by the position (food security, WASH/shelter, livelihood and protection)
  • Solid experience in staff management in a cross-cultural environment
  • Strong experience in conducting large scale distribution in remote locations with limited humanitarian presence
  • Proven ability to build external relationships with diplomacy, tact and professionalism in a complex and demanding environment
  • Proficiency in using common computer packages and financial software, e.g., Microsoft Word, Microsoft Excel, Microsoft PowerPoint, etc
  • Ability to work in an isolated and challenging environment
  • Strong reporting, report-writing and assessment skills
